Animal Welfare

Executive Summary

These Global Guidelines aim to bridge differing perceptions of welfare around the world and help veterinary teams to tackle the ethical questions and moral issues which impact welfare. They also offer guidance to ensure that, in addition to providing physical health advice and therapy to their patients, veterinary teams can advocate for their psychological, social and environmental wellbeing.
